Audit item 14 — Map-tile prefetcher (Wrenfold service). Verify: prefetch radius capped at 3 zoom levels; cache eviction runs nightly; no tiles fetched for regions outside the licensed Selmere dataset. Check the quota counter resets at 00:00 UTC and that failed fetches back off exponentially. Last audit found the radius cap disabled in staging — confirm it's re-enabled. Record findings in the Wrenfold audit log. Any exceptions must be approved by the maintainer named below.

account owner for bawip-tahag: Raleth Quenok

**Mgmt Meeting Minutes — Retiring the Brightline Range**

Quick recap for sales leads at Fenholt Supplies: we agreed to retire the Brightline fixture range by year-end. Remaining stock moves to clearance pricing next month, and accounts on standing orders get migrated to the Lumetta range. Trade-in incentives were approved in principle. The confidential note on next steps sits just below.

board note of bajof-bajeg: The pricing group signed off on a budget of $13.4 million for Project Sildor. The renewal with Lamixek Holdings closes at $48.9 million a year, 49 percent above the last contract.

## Possible Acquisition: Brightfen Tools (Managers Only)

Quick heads-up for branch managers — we're in early talks to acquire Brightfen Tools, the workshop-equipment outfit with depots in Northvale and Summerlea. If it goes through, their inventory system folds into ours over about six months, and some branch territories get redrawn. Nothing is signed yet, so keep this off the floor. We'll update this page as talks progress. The thinking behind the move is below.

confidential, kagep-kahof: Druokax Systems plans to lower the Ulaath list price by 53 percent in March.

[ ] Reception desk relocation — confirm awareness. As of Monday, the main reception desk at Quillbrook Tower moves from Level 3 to the ground floor atrium, beside the east lift bank. Night shift must redirect all arrivals there; the old Level 3 desk will be unstaffed and its phone disconnected. Walk the new starter past both locations on their first round so the change is clear. Ground-floor desk access after 22:00 requires the door code below.

turnstile pass: bdg-YPPQB-52010